Haylie Duff is one yummy mummy-to-be, but that doesn't mean she wants to spend the rest of her pregnancy dressed in maternity clothes!

But, as the 30-year-old celebrity chef and Real Girl's Kitchen host tells Racked Miami, after "fighting the good fight on buying maternity clothes," she now has "this massive belly" and "can't deny that I'm pregnant any longer!"

"I've tried to not go too maternity," she clarifies, "but at a certain point you've got to have room, you know?"

She adores one item in particular, too: her David Lerner maternity leggings! "Those have probably been my favorite the whole time I've been pregnant," she says. "I'm sort of sad to lose them once I'm done with them."

Haylie might be dressing to accommodate for her baby bump now, but it's certainly not slowing her down. "I did Soulcycle through my whole pregnancy and I go on walks with friends," she tells Racked Miami. "You know, I've worked through most of it shooting season two of The Real Girl's Kitchen. So I've been active in general. Chasing my little nephew [Luca, sister Hilary Duff's 2-year-old son] around and playing with him has been exercise enough! We've taken him to the beach plenty of times."

Of course, Haylie's been eating healthy throughout her pregnancy as well. One place she stocks up on lots of fruits, veggies and fresh foods? Local farmer's markets! She has some advice, too, if you're planning to stroll through one to pick up your groceries. "Know what you're kind of looking for so you're not buying a bunch of random stuff that you don't end up using," she says. "Because everything at the farmer's market is fresh, right? So it goes bad a lot faster than what you get in a grocery store."
